Why Local SEO Matters for Auto Repair Shops?

Screenshot showing the top 3 transactional keywords (‘auto repair near me,’ ‘auto shop near me,’ and ‘brake repair near me‘) and their monthly search volumes for February 2025 in the United States:

Imagine someone’s car breaks down, and they pull out their phone to search “auto repair near me.” If your shop doesn’t appear at the top of Google, you’re losing business to competitors who have invested in local SEO.

Local SEO helps your shop:

  • Appear in Google’s Local Pack (the top 3 map results).
  • Show up in organic search results when people search for car repairs in your area.
  • Get more calls, website visits, and foot traffic.

1. Claim and Optimize Your Google Business Profile (GBP)

Your Google Business Profile (formerly Google My Business) is your shop’s most valuable online asset. Follow these steps to optimize it:

  • Claim your listing if you haven’t already at Google Business Profile.
  • Use your real business name—no keyword stuffing (Google penalizes this).
  • Enter your correct address, phone number, and hours of operation.
  • Select the right categories (e.g., “Auto Repair Shop”).
  • Upload high-quality photos of your shop, team, and services.
  • Write a detailed business description using relevant keywords naturally.
  • Encourage customer reviews—they help build trust and boost rankings.

2. Optimize Your Website for Local SEO

Your website is your 24/7 salesperson. Here’s how to make it work for local SEO:

a) Use Local Keywords Strategically

  • Include terms like “auto repair in [city]” or “best car mechanic near [location]” in page titles, meta descriptions, and content.
  • Create location-specific service pages (e.g., “Brake Repair in [City]”).
  • Use structured data (schema markup) to help Google understand your business details.

b) Mobile-Friendly and Fast Loading

Most customers search for auto repair services on their phones. Ensure your website is:

  • Mobile-friendly and easy to navigate.
  • Fast-loading (Google favors sites that load quickly).
  • Clickable with a visible call button so customers can call you directly.

c) Add a Location Page

  • Include your business name, address, phone number (NAP), and a Google Map embed.

  • List your services and service areas clearly.

4. Get More Online Reviews (and Respond to Them)

Reviews are SEO gold for auto repair shops. They influence rankings and build trust with potential customers.

How to Get More Reviews:

  • Ask happy customers to leave a review on Google and Yelp.
  • Send follow-up texts or emails with a review link.
  • Offer a small discount for customers who leave feedback.

How to Respond to Reviews:

  • Thank customers for positive reviews: “Thanks, John! Glad we could fix your brakes quickly!”
  • Address negative reviews professionally: “We’re sorry you had this experience. Please call us so we can make it right.”

5. Local Link Building: Earn Backlinks from Local Sources

Backlinks (links from other websites to yours) improve your site’s authority. Here’s how to get local backlinks:

  • Partner with local businesses (e.g., auto parts stores, car dealerships) and ask for a mention.
  • Get listed on your local Chamber of Commerce website.
  • Sponsor local events and get a link from their website.
  • Write guest blogs for local news sites or auto industry blogs.

8. Track Your Local SEO Performance

Monitor your efforts to see what’s working. Use these tools:

  • Google Business Insights (to track calls, clicks, and views on your GBP profile).
  • Google Search Console (to see what keywords bring traffic).
  • Google Analytics (to monitor website traffic and conversions).
